The SY100EL16VK is a precision, high-speed differential receiver designed for use in various communication and data transmission applications. As part of Micrel's high-performance ECL (Emitter Coupled Logic) family, this device offers exceptional speed and low skew, making it suitable for demanding applications where signal integrity and timing accuracy are crucial.
Applications:
- High-speed data transmission systems
- Clock distribution networks
- Level translation
- Test and measurement equipment
- Networking equipment
Features:
- High bandwidth: Typically operates at frequencies exceeding 3 GHz.
- Low skew: Ensures minimal timing differences between output signals.
- ECL compatibility: Designed to interface with other ECL devices seamlessly.
- Differential inputs: Provides excellent noise immunity.
- Internal input termination: Simplifies board layout and reduces component count.
- Operating voltage: Typically operates at -5.5V to -4.2V.
- Output Enable Control: Allows the output to be disabled for testing or power saving purposes.

The SY100EL16VK differential receiver converts differential input signals to single-ended output signals. Its high bandwidth and low skew characteristics make it ideal for applications requiring precise timing and minimal signal distortion. The device's internal input termination resistors further simplify the design process by eliminating the need for external components.
This device is commonly used in clock distribution networks, where it ensures that clock signals arrive at different points in the system with minimal timing differences. It is also used in level translation applications, where it converts signals from one voltage level to another while maintaining signal integrity.
The SY100EL16VK is available in a variety of packages, including SOIC and QFN. The specific package option affects the device's thermal performance and footprint. Designers should carefully consider these factors when selecting the appropriate package for their application.
